Senior Relationship Manager - Corporate Banking (Newport, CA)

Flagstar Bank is seeking a Senior Relationship Manager for Corporate Banking to focus on new business development and relationship management with companies in Southern California. The role involves generating revenue by building relationships with clients, overseeing a team approach to relationship management, and ensuring credit quality within the portfolio.

BankingFinanceFinancial Services

Responsibilities

New Business Origination: Developing and maintaining relationships to generate direct deal flow; Coordinate a team approach to approving and closing new deals to grow assets and revenues, while optimizing profitability
Relationship Management: In partnership with portfolio managers, engage with borrowers to identify lending opportunities and to expand corporate relationships cross-selling banking solutions
Credit Quality: Working with portfolio managers, ensure proactive monitoring of portfolio credit quality (timely financial statement gathering, monitoring clients’ credit compliance, properly analyzing financial information, and recommending appropriate corrective actions to assure appropriate portfolio credit quality). Ultimately, the Relationship Manager is responsible for maintaining acceptable portfolio risk exposure
Maintaining Knowledge: Staying abreast of industry trends and market conditions that could impact clients and the bank
